Jennifer T.

Stopped in for the first time. We sat outside which is a cozy little area in the front with two tables .They have cute solar lamps on the table as well as some floor lamps which are a great touch. Our server was wonderful. Friendly and very helpful when it came to working with my food issues. I ordered the Filet and my husband ordered the Tomahawk Pork Chop. Our dinners came with a salad which was very tasty. Dinner- Filet 6 oz- The presentation was nice. The Steak however was overcooked. Our server agreed and apologized and took it back to the kitchen. Unfortunately she left my potato and the asparagus which were so overcooked they just shredded when I attempted to cut through them. I covered it with a napkin to keep warm. She returned a bit later this time with a very very raw steak. So we had to send it back as it was too raw to eat. I told my husband to go ahead and eat his dinner at this point as he was waiting for me. They refired it but at this point it was no longer juicy from being cut into and refired. My potato was cold as well. I just ate it since I was hungry and I want to eat with him. Tomahawk Pork - Looked delicious. The flavor was good, the sweet potato mash was good but he thought the pork itself was tough and overpriced. Our server gave us a complementary dessert. We chose the Limoncello Cake. Wow!! Amazing. They don't make it in house sadly because I might have purchased one for a birthday coming up. I also had an Espresso Martini which was good. Not everything was perfect, steak gets overcooked. How our server handled all of this made everything better. She was kind and apologetic and went out of her way to ensure we still had a nice time. I can't remember her name sadly. All of the staff was great and because of this we will return and try again.

Happy Birthday to me!!!!!! I was beyond excited to finally make it to the highly anticipated Vault restaurant in downtown Fenton. First of all, I love to check out new spots and The Vault has been on my list for quite some time. This dining experience was well overdue and it was finally time to celebrate. I found out that they do take reservations on Open Table, but the weekends are booked out for months. Fenton is about an hour from my house and I didn't know if I would be able to snag a table, so I decided to spin the wheel of fate and head to Fenton anyway. I love downtown Fenton; it holds a very special place in my heart, so going back to visit was a welcomed adventure anyway. Walking through the door, I was greeted by a warm, friendly smile. I explained my long anticipated journey to The Vault and the hostess remarked, I have a special spot just for you! WHOOP WHOOP!!! What a Kismet Night this was going to be. The Vault was on SLAM for a Friday night. The layout of the space is unique with two floors and a bar located on each level. Plush velvet booths line the perimeter and oversized, leather sofas create a communal space for larger groups on the main level. The 1st floor bar is quite expansive and a private table for 8 can be reserved in the former vault of the building. A tall stairway leads you to the second floor, which has a very hip vibe and fun interior. The bar upstairs is much smaller, but the bartender kept the party rolling! The second floor was most certainly where the party was at last night. We were seated with a fun group of locals who kept us entertained for the evening. They even bought me a few drinks for my belated celebration. By this time, I was starving!!!! I couldn't wait to try a few items on the menu. Being a more upscale restaurant, I thought the menu options were fantastic and the price point, spot on. The crafted cocktail & wine list is quite extensive. The cocktails were AMAZING! My favorite drink was the Alarm Clock: Vodka, Raspberry Liqueur, Simple Syrup, Lemon, Dandelion, and BUBBLES!!!! Did you hear that....BUBBLES!!!!!!! OMG.....the best drink, I've ever tasted and that says a lot! I indulged and had two of them. I also tasted the League of Shadows, which contains Valentine's White Blossom Vodka, and The Principal, which was so unique in flavor: Mammoth Rye Whiskey, Mammoth Coffee Liqueur, Cinnamon Infused Carpano Antica, Vanilla Infused Nocino, and Ango & Spiced Cherry Bitters. The Vault is known for their seafood and prime beef options on the menu. We ordered the Shrimp Rockefeller, Mussels A Diablo, Crab Hush Puppies with caper remoulade, Seafood Crab Bisque, the Hand Cut Filet Mignon with Mushrooms, Asparagus, & Diced Potatoes. We went a little overboard on the food, but we were able to split everything. The Shrimp Rockefeller was amazing, the sauce for the mussels packed a little heat and the addition of sausage to the sauce, perfection! The soup was rich and creamy, served with a generous amount of crab meat on top. The Hushpuppies were good, and the 8oz. Filet was perfectly cooked. We ordered mushrooms for the steak, which I recommend. They also make their own steak sauce, which is a bit more on the sweet side but pairs perfectly with the meat. For dessert, we opted for the Caramel Mascarpone Cheesecake with Strawberries on top. One word: Divine! Overall, I would give The Vault 10+* if it were an option! Everything from the food, drinks, staff and atmosphere....top notch! It was everything I had hoped for and It was most certainly worth the wait. Fenton, you have a true gem in your city! I can't wait to come back.
